C31-C34 methylated squalenes from a Bolivian strain of Botryococcus braunii

Three new triterpenes, synthesized by a Bolivian strain of the green microalga Botryococcus braunii, were isolated and their chemical structures determined by ID and 2D NMR, and mass spectrometry. These compounds are tri-, di-, and mono-methylsqualenes, co-occurring with the previously identified tetramethylsqualene and some C-30-C-32 botryococcenes. In this strain, methylated squalenes constitute up to 24% of the total hydrocarbons and 4.5% of the dry biomass. The results of a pulse-chase experiment with L-[Me-C-13] methionine provide evidence for the origin of these compounds via methylation of squalene at positions 3, 7, 18 and 22. (C) 2004 Elsevier Ltd.
